Only 3 days until the show, can't wait!

The response for this show has been fantastic so far. If the weather gods are kind on the day it should be huge.... there should be a bit of everything to see on the day.

* We also have a good variety of stall holders coming.
* The CFA are pumped up and ready to run the food and drinks for us, as well as Mr. Whippy and a mobile 'coffee dude'.
* Jumping castle for the kids
* Goodie bags for the 1st 200 cars through the gates.
* There will be a variety of giveaways, vouchers, and awards
* Trophies include Rare Spares "Real Street" and "Real Restoration". There's also "People's Choice", plus a few others like "Tough Street" etc. Find out more on the day!

Unfortunately the live music has fallen through - the Manhattan Hotel couldn't get the permit for amplified music (too residential). Not to worry, the show must go on, and it's something we can work towards for next year when looking at bigger and better venues.

And don't forgot - The Manhattan Hotel have an awesome bistro area, TAB's, and a lager bar with beer garden.... just in case you get bored looking at cool cars!

Hope to see some of you on Sunday :)

I'm still buzzing after a huge day today. For our first show it certainly exceeded our expectations, with well over 300 cars passing through the gates. Not only that, but the overall quality was incredible.

 

What a great day, perfect weather, great cars, and great people! Big crowd all day.... thanks to everyone who came along! As expected, it turned into a constantly rotating car show, with people coming and going from 7:30am right up beyond 3pm... it seemed to peak around lunchtime, with numbers falling off pretty quickly after that. I had a bloody ball smile.gif

We achieved our primary objective of gathering a large variety of cars, and the feedback we're receiving on this alone is fantastic!

I don't have a final figure just yet (stay tuned), but some big funds were raised for the CFA which is excellent. Every cent raised today went straight to those guys, and they did a great job manning the food and drinks all day.

I'm absolutely buggered... pics will follow at some stage soon.

 

Keen to hear any feedback - positive or negative - to help improve next years event....
